They are running times on par with Speed GT. Which is about 7-12 seconds a lap slower than ALMS depending on the length of the track and how close to the front you are. They might look docile, but that's because the drivers are so good they don't look like they are trying. Many of the ALMS cars are limited to 430-470 or so hp too.

Since ALSM is endurance racing, you wont probably wont see as much action at the controls.. They are conserving tires, playing it fairly safe, and not running 11/10th's like one would see in qualifying, or a sprint race.
